Покроковий посібник із впровадження Google Analytics 4 (GA4), що охоплює налаштування, конфігурацію, відстеження подій, аналіз даних та найкращі практики.
Google Analytics 4 (GA4): вичерпний посібник з упровадження
Ласкаво просимо до вичерпного посібника з Google Analytics 4 (GA4). Universal Analytics (UA) припинив роботу 1 липня 2023 року, зробивши GA4 новим стандартом для вебаналітики та аналітики додатків. Цей посібник допоможе вам зрозуміти та ефективно впровадити GA4, незалежно від вашого місцезнаходження чи типу бізнесу. Ми розглянемо все: від початкового налаштування до розширеного відстеження подій та аналізу даних, надаючи практичні приклади та корисні поради.
Чому GA4 є незамінним
GA4 є значним кроком уперед порівняно з Universal Analytics, пропонуючи декілька ключових переваг:
- Готовність до майбутнього: GA4 розроблений для адаптації до мінливого цифрового ландшафта, включно з правилами конфіденційності та зміною поведінки користувачів.
- Кросплатформне відстеження: Відстежуйте шлях користувача на вебсайтах і в додатках в єдиному представленні.
- Модель даних на основі подій: Отримуйте глибші інсайти про взаємодію користувачів завдяки гнучкій та настроюваній моделі даних на основі подій.
- Машинне навчання: Використовуйте можливості машинного навчання Google для отримання прогнозних інсайтів та автоматизованого аналізу.
- Дизайн, орієнтований на конфіденційність: Створений з урахуванням конфіденційності користувачів, GA4 пропонує розширені функції анонімізації даних та керування згодою.
Покроковий посібник з упровадження GA4
1. Налаштування ресурсу GA4
Спочатку вам потрібно створити ресурс GA4 у вашому обліковому записі Google Analytics:
- Увійдіть до Google Analytics: Перейдіть на analytics.google.com і увійдіть за допомогою свого облікового запису Google.
- Створіть новий ресурс: Якщо у вас ще немає ресурсу GA4, натисніть «Адміністратор» у нижньому лівому куті, а потім «Створити ресурс». Якщо у вас є ресурс UA, ми рекомендуємо створити новий ресурс GA4 паралельно з ним для відстеження даних одночасно протягом перехідного періоду.
- Деталі ресурсу: Введіть назву вашого ресурсу, часовий пояс звітів та валюту. Оберіть значення, що відповідають основному місцезнаходженню вашого бізнесу та цільовій аудиторії. Наприклад, бізнес, орієнтований на клієнтів у Європі, ймовірно, обере європейський часовий пояс та валюту євро.
- Інформація про компанію: Надайте інформацію про вашу компанію, наприклад, категорію галузі та розмір бізнесу. Це допоможе Google персоналізувати свої інсайти та рекомендації.
- Виберіть ваші бізнес-цілі: Вкажіть причини, з яких ви використовуєте GA4. Варіанти включають залучення потенційних клієнтів, збільшення онлайн-продажів та підвищення впізнаваності бренду. Це додатково налаштовує досвід використання аналітики.
2. Налаштування потоків даних
Потоки даних — це джерела даних, що надходять до вашого ресурсу GA4. Ви можете створювати потоки даних для вашого вебсайту, додатку для iOS та додатку для Android.
- Виберіть платформу: Оберіть платформу, яку ви хочете відстежувати (Веб, додаток для iOS або додаток для Android).
- Веб-потік даних: Якщо ви обираєте «Веб», введіть URL-адресу вашого вебсайту та назву потоку. GA4 автоматично увімкне розширене відстеження, яке фіксує поширені події, такі як перегляди сторінок, прокручування, вихідні кліки, пошук по сайту, взаємодія з відео та завантаження файлів.
- Потік даних додатку: Якщо ви обираєте «додаток для iOS» або «додаток для Android», вам потрібно буде надати назву пакета вашого додатку (Android) або ідентифікатор пакета (iOS) та слідувати інструкціям на екрані для інтеграції SDK GA4 у ваш додаток.
- Встановіть код відстеження GA4: Для веб-потоків даних вам потрібно встановити код відстеження GA4 (також відомий як глобальний тег сайту або gtag.js) на вашому вебсайті. Ви можете знайти цей код у деталях потоку даних. Існує кілька способів встановлення коду відстеження:
- Безпосередньо в HTML вашого вебсайту: Скопіюйте та вставте фрагмент коду в розділ
<head>
кожної сторінки, яку ви хочете відстежувати. - За допомогою системи керування тегами (напр., Google Tag Manager): Це рекомендований підхід для більшості користувачів, оскільки він дозволяє легше керувати та налаштовувати вашу конфігурацію відстеження. Використання Google Tag Manager вимагає створення нового тегу та вибору «Google Analytics: Конфігурація GA4» як типу тегу. Потім введіть ваш ідентифікатор відстеження (знайдений у деталях потоку даних) та налаштуйте бажані тригери.
- За допомогою плагіна CMS (напр., плагіни для WordPress): Багато систем управління контентом (CMS) пропонують плагіни, які спрощують процес інтеграції GA4. Знайдіть плагін GA4 у каталозі плагінів вашої CMS та дотримуйтесь його інструкцій.
3. Розширене відстеження
Розширене відстеження GA4 автоматично фіксує кілька поширених подій без необхідності додавати будь-який додатковий код. Ці події включають:
- Перегляди сторінок: Відстежує кожне завантаження або перезавантаження сторінки.
- Прокручування: Відстежує, коли користувач прокручує сторінку до кінця (поріг 90%).
- Вихідні кліки: Відстежує кліки, які ведуть користувачів з вашого вебсайту.
- Пошук по сайту: Відстежує, коли користувачі здійснюють пошук на вашому вебсайті за допомогою внутрішньої функції пошуку.
- Взаємодія з відео: Відстежує початок, прогрес та завершення перегляду для вбудованих відео з YouTube.
- Завантаження файлів: Відстежує завантаження файлів з поширеними розширеннями (напр., .pdf, .doc, .xls).
Ви можете налаштувати параметри розширеного відстеження в інтерфейсі GA4. Наприклад, ви можете вимкнути певні події або налаштувати додаткові параметри для відстеження пошуку по сайту.
4. Відстеження подій
Модель даних GA4 на основі подій надає гнучкий спосіб відстеження взаємодій користувачів, що виходять за рамки автоматично відстежуваних подій розширеного відстеження. Ви можете визначати власні події для відстеження конкретних дій, які є важливими для вашого бізнесу.
Розуміння подій
У GA4 все є подією. Перегляди сторінок, прокручування, кліки, надсилання форм та відтворення відео — все це вважається подіями. Кожна подія має назву і може мати пов'язані з нею параметри, які надають додатковий контекст.
Впровадження власних подій
Існує кілька способів впровадження власних подій у GA4:
- За допомогою Google Tag Manager (GTM): Це найбільш гнучкий та рекомендований підхід. Ви можете створювати власні теги подій у GTM та активувати їх на основі конкретних дій або умов користувача.
- Безпосередньо в коді вашого вебсайту: Ви можете використовувати API gtag.js для надсилання власних подій безпосередньо з коду вашого вебсайту.
- Використання DebugView у GA4: Це дозволяє тестувати ваші події в режимі реального часу.
Приклад: відстеження надсилання форм
Припустимо, ви хочете відстежувати надсилання форм на вашому вебсайті. Ось як ви можете це зробити за допомогою Google Tag Manager:
- Створіть тригер у GTM: Створіть новий тригер у GTM, який спрацьовує при надсиланні форми. Ви можете використовувати тип тригера «Надсилання форми» та налаштувати його так, щоб він спрацьовував для конкретних форм на основі їхніх ідентифікаторів або CSS-селекторів.
- Створіть тег події GA4: Створіть новий тег у GTM та виберіть «Google Analytics: Подія GA4» як тип тегу.
- Налаштуйте тег:
- Назва тегу: Дайте вашому тегу описову назву, наприклад, «GA4 - Надсилання форми».
- Тег конфігурації: Виберіть ваш тег конфігурації GA4.
- Назва події: Введіть назву для вашої події, наприклад, «form_submit».
- Параметри події: Додайте будь-які релевантні параметри до події, такі як ID форми, URL-адреса сторінки та електронна адреса користувача (якщо доступно). Наприклад:
{ "form_id": "contact-form", "page_url": "{{Page URL}}" }
. Переконайтеся, що ви дотримуєтесь правил конфіденційності (наприклад, GDPR) при зборі персональних даних. - Тригер: Виберіть тригер надсилання форми, який ви створили на кроці 1.
- Протестуйте та опублікуйте: Використовуйте режим попереднього перегляду GTM, щоб протестувати ваш тег та переконатися, що він спрацьовує коректно. Коли ви будете задоволені, опублікуйте ваш контейнер GTM.
Приклад: відстеження кліку на кнопку
Припустимо, ви хочете відстежувати кліки на певну кнопку на вашому вебсайті. Ось як ви можете це зробити за допомогою Google Tag Manager:
- Створіть тригер у GTM: Створіть новий тригер у GTM, який спрацьовує при кліку на певну кнопку. Ви можете використовувати тип тригера «Клік - Усі елементи» або «Клік - Лише посилання» (залежно від того, чи є кнопка посиланням
<a>
чи елементом<button>
) і налаштувати його так, щоб він спрацьовував на основі ID кнопки, CSS-класу або тексту. - Створіть тег події GA4: Створіть новий тег у GTM та виберіть «Google Analytics: Подія GA4» як тип тегу.
- Налаштуйте тег:
- Назва тегу: Дайте вашому тегу описову назву, наприклад, «GA4 - Клік на кнопку».
- Тег конфігурації: Виберіть ваш тег конфігурації GA4.
- Назва події: Введіть назву для вашої події, наприклад, «button_click».
- Параметри події: Додайте будь-які релевантні параметри до події, такі як ID кнопки, URL-адреса сторінки та текст кнопки. Наприклад:
{ "button_id": "submit-button", "page_url": "{{Page URL}}", "button_text": "Submit" }
. - Тригер: Виберіть тригер кліку на кнопку, який ви створили на кроці 1.
- Протестуйте та опублікуйте: Використовуйте режим попереднього перегляду GTM, щоб протестувати ваш тег та переконатися, що він спрацьовує коректно. Коли ви будете задоволені, опублікуйте ваш контейнер GTM.
5. Визначення конверсій
Конверсії — це конкретні події, які ви вважаєте цінними діями на вашому вебсайті або в додатку, наприклад, надсилання форм, покупки або створення облікових записів. Визначення конверсій у GA4 дозволяє відстежувати успішність ваших маркетингових кампаній та оптимізувати ваш вебсайт або додаток для досягнення кращих результатів.
Позначення подій як конверсій
Щоб позначити подію як конверсію в GA4, просто перейдіть до «Конфігурація» > «Події» в інтерфейсі GA4 і перемкніть перемикач «Позначити як конверсію» біля події, яку ви хочете відстежувати як конверсію. У GA4 є обмеження в 30 конверсій на ресурс.
Створення власних подій-конверсій
Ви також можете створювати власні події-конверсії на основі конкретних параметрів або умов події. Наприклад, ви можете відстежувати конверсії лише для користувачів, які надсилають форму з певним значенням у конкретному полі.
6. Ідентифікація користувачів
GA4 пропонує кілька варіантів для ідентифікації користувачів на різних пристроях та платформах, що дозволяє більш точно відстежувати шлях користувача:
- User-ID: Якщо у вас є система входу на вашому вебсайті або в додатку, ви можете використовувати функцію User-ID для ідентифікації зареєстрованих користувачів на різних пристроях. Це забезпечує найбільш точну ідентифікацію користувачів.
- Google Signals: Google Signals використовує дані користувачів Google для ідентифікації користувачів, які увійшли у свої облікові записи Google та увімкнули персоналізацію реклами. Це може допомогти вам відстежувати шлях користувача на різних пристроях, але це залежить від налаштувань конфіденційності користувача.
- Device-ID: GA4 також використовує ідентифікатори пристроїв (такі як файли cookie та ідентифікатори екземплярів додатку) для ідентифікації користувачів. Однак цей метод менш точний, ніж User-ID або Google Signals, оскільки він не працює на різних пристроях або в різних браузерах.
Щоб увімкнути Google Signals, перейдіть до «Адміністратор» > «Налаштування даних» > «Збір даних» в інтерфейсі GA4 та активуйте збір даних Google Signals.
7. Налагодження та тестування
Важливо ретельно налагодити та протестувати вашу реалізацію GA4, щоб переконатися, що ваші дані є точними та надійними. GA4 надає кілька інструментів для налагодження та тестування:
- GA4 DebugView: DebugView дозволяє бачити дані з вашого вебсайту або додатку в режимі реального часу під час взаємодії з ним. Це корисно для перевірки того, що ваші події спрацьовують коректно і що ваші дані збираються, як очікувалося. Щоб увімкнути режим налагодження, вам потрібно встановити розширення для браузера Google Analytics Debugger або встановити спеціальний файл cookie.
- Режим попереднього перегляду Google Tag Manager: Режим попереднього перегляду GTM дозволяє тестувати ваші теги та тригери перед їх публікацією. Це корисно для перевірки того, що ваші теги спрацьовують коректно і що ваші дані надсилаються до GA4.
- Звіти в реальному часі: Звіти в реальному часі в GA4 надають швидкий огляд активності на вашому вебсайті або в додатку. Це може бути корисно для виявлення будь-яких негайних проблем з вашою реалізацією відстеження.
8. Аналіз ваших даних
Після того, як ви впровадили GA4 та зібрали деякі дані, ви можете почати аналізувати свої дані, щоб отримати інсайти про поведінку користувачів та оптимізувати ваш вебсайт або додаток для кращих результатів. GA4 пропонує широкий спектр звітів та інструментів аналізу:
- Звіти: GA4 надає різноманітні готові звіти, включаючи звіти про залучення, звіти про взаємодію, звіти про монетизацію та звіти про утримання. Ці звіти надають загальний огляд ваших даних.
- Дослідження: Функція «Дослідження» дозволяє створювати власні звіти та аналізи. Це корисно для відповіді на конкретні питання про ваші дані та для виявлення прихованих інсайтів. Доступно багато технік дослідження, включаючи дослідження послідовностей, дослідження шляхів, вільну форму та перетин сегментів.
- Центр аналізу: Центр аналізу — це центральне місце для доступу до всіх інструментів аналізу GA4.
Ключові метрики для відстеження
Ось деякі ключові метрики, які вам слід відстежувати в GA4:
- Користувачі: Кількість унікальних користувачів, які відвідали ваш вебсайт або додаток.
- Сесії: Кількість сесій на вашому вебсайті або в додатку.
- Рівень залучення: Відсоток сесій, які тривали довше 10 секунд, мали принаймні 2 перегляди сторінок або мали подію-конверсію.
- Конверсії: Кількість подій-конверсій.
- Дохід: Загальний дохід, отриманий вашим вебсайтом або додатком.
9. Розширене налаштування GA4
Міждоменне відстеження
Якщо ваш вебсайт охоплює кілька доменів, вам потрібно налаштувати міждоменне відстеження для безперешкодного відстеження шляху користувача між цими доменами. Це включає додавання того ж тегу GA4 до всіх ваших доменів та налаштування GA4 для розпізнавання цих доменів як частини одного вебсайту.
Піддомени
Для піддоменів зазвичай не потрібна спеціальна конфігурація. GA4 за замовчуванням розглядає піддомени як частину одного домену.
Анонімізація IP-адрес
GA4 автоматично анонімізує IP-адреси, тому вам не потрібно налаштовувати анонімізацію IP-адрес вручну. Однак ви повинні переконатися, що дотримуєтесь усіх застосовних правил конфіденційності, таких як GDPR та CCPA.
Зберігання даних
GA4 дозволяє налаштувати період зберігання даних на рівні користувача. Ви можете вибрати зберігання даних протягом 2 або 14 місяців. Важливо вибрати період зберігання даних, який відповідає потребам вашого бізнесу та дотримується застосовних правил конфіденційності. Щоб налаштувати параметри зберігання даних, перейдіть до Адміністратор > Налаштування даних > Зберігання даних.
10. Найкращі практики впровадження GA4
- Плануйте свою стратегію відстеження: Перш ніж почати впроваджувати GA4, знайдіть час, щоб спланувати свою стратегію відстеження. Визначте ключові події, які ви хочете відстежувати, та визначте свої цілі конверсії.
- Використовуйте Google Tag Manager: Google Tag Manager (GTM) — це рекомендований підхід для впровадження GA4, оскільки він дозволяє легше керувати та налаштовувати вашу конфігурацію відстеження.
- Ретельно тестуйте ваше впровадження: Використовуйте DebugView у GA4 та режим попереднього перегляду GTM, щоб ретельно протестувати ваше впровадження перед його публікацією.
- Регулярно відстежуйте свої дані: Регулярно відстежуйте свої дані, щоб переконатися, що вони точні та надійні.
- Будьте в курсі новин: Google постійно оновлює GA4, тому важливо бути в курсі останніх функцій та найкращих практик.
- Документуйте ваше впровадження: Ведіть детальну документацію вашого впровадження GA4, включаючи назви подій, параметри та тригери. Це полегшить підтримку та усунення несправностей у вашій конфігурації відстеження.
GA4 та конфіденційність
Повага до конфіденційності користувачів є першочерговою. Забезпечте дотримання глобальних правил, таких як GDPR (Загальний регламент про захист даних) та CCPA (Каліфорнійський закон про захист прав споживачів). Впроваджуйте рішення для управління згодою, щоб отримати згоду користувачів перед відстеженням. Анонімізуйте IP-адреси (хоча GA4 робить це за замовчуванням) та надайте користувачам контроль над їхніми даними.
Висновок
GA4 — це потужна аналітична платформа, яка може надати цінні інсайти про поведінку користувачів. Дотримуючись кроків, викладених у цьому посібнику, ви зможете ефективно впровадити GA4 та почати відстежувати дані, які є найбільш важливими для вашого бізнесу. Не забувайте планувати свою стратегію відстеження, використовувати Google Tag Manager, ретельно тестувати ваше впровадження та регулярно відстежувати свої дані. Успіхів та щасливого аналізу!
Додаткові ресурси
- Довідковий центр Google Analytics 4: https://support.google.com/analytics#topic=9143232
- Документація Google Tag Manager: https://support.google.com/tagmanager/?hl=uk#topic=3441532